Аннотация
The investigation is focused on the study of the structure, fracture, and phase composition of standard industrial pseudo-alpha-titanium alloy and the same titanium alloy alloyed with ruthenium. Also, the possibility to increase the low-cycle fatigue and resistance to stress corrosion cracking of industrial titanium allow using cathodic alloying with ruthenium.
